The inherited rank

Animal fact

Spotted Hyena clans are matrilineal, and a cub's social rank is inherited directly from its mother and typically stays stable across generations, with daughters usually settling in just below her.

The queue for outsiders

Animal fact

All adult females outrank all immigrant males. A male who joins a new clan after leaving his own enters a dominance queue at the very bottom and can only rise as more males join behind him or senior males die off.

The bite built to finish

Animal fact

The Spotted Hyena's jaws and teeth are proportionally among the strongest of any living mammal, built for cracking open the bones other predators leave behind and cannot use.

The laugh that is not a laugh

Animal fact

The Spotted Hyena's high-pitched giggle is produced mainly around competitive feeding, and research shows it encodes the caller's age, sex, and dominance rank, not amusement.

The commute

Animal fact

When local prey thins, a clan will travel well outside its own territory to reach migrating herds; a single lactating female may make forty to fifty such trips and cover thousands of kilometres in a year.

The recognized clan-mate

Animal fact

Spotted Hyenas track individual clan members and can recognize third-party relationships and rank between animals that are not even interacting with them, a level of social tracking rare outside primates.
